SFV H1

The SFV H1 is a standard-tread farm tractor produced by SFV in Vierzon, France from 1933 to 1940. It features a 10.3L single-cylinder liquid-cooled diesel engine producing an estimated 24.8 kW. The tractor has a 3-speed gear transmission with 3 forward and 1 reverse gears, two-wheel drive, and an open operator station. It has a wheelbase of 75.6 inches, length of 129.9 inches, width of 68.9 inches, and weighs 6614 lbs. The front tires are 6.50-20 and the rear tires are 12.75-28. The SFV H1 was part of a series including the HV1 and H2 models.
